Summary of the comparison
The Hertfordshire & Essex High School and Science College and St Mary's Catholic School are secondary schools in Bishop's Stortford.
The Hertfordshire & Essex High School and Science College scores 77 out of 100 (grade B, strong) and St Mary's Catholic School scores 70 out of 100 (grade B, strong). The Hertfordshire & Essex High School and Science College is ahead on our composite score.
The Hertfordshire & Essex High School and Science College was judged Outstanding and St Mary's Catholic School was judged strong.
On GCSE Attainment 8, the latest published figures are 63.6 for The Hertfordshire & Essex High School and Science College and 57.6 for St Mary's Catholic School.
GCSE Attainment 8 has fallen at The Hertfordshire & Essex High School and Science College (65.9 in 2021-22, 63.6 in 2024-25) and has held broadly level at St Mary's Catholic School (57.5 in 2021-22, 57.6 in 2024-25).
